Output fba816aeef8d52ec3630246da5b11ab1bd646bea7c8f422543064abc71ebb524:0

value
6676037160
script pubkey
OP_0 OP_PUSHBYTES_20 8595f7edc53730207cb478e9e40c22bc3d54e2a2
address
bc1qsk2l0mw9xuczql950r57grpzhs74fc4z3e6zem
transaction
fba816aeef8d52ec3630246da5b11ab1bd646bea7c8f422543064abc71ebb524
spent
true